Where does “dönke” come from?

dönke (Limburgish) comes from Middle Dutch dunken, from Old Dutch thunken, from Proto-West Germanic *þunkijan, from Proto-Germanic þunkijaną — to seem, to appear.

dönke (Limburgish): to appear, seem
